Understanding Student Visas as a Launchpad

A student visa is your first step into a world of global possibilities. It allows you to immerse yourself in a new culture while acquiring an education that is internationally recognized. However, many students aspire to turn their temporary stay into something more enduring. The right strategy involves understanding how your student visa can serve as a launchpad to permanent residency.

  • Research Visa Conditions: Each country has specific conditions attached to student visas, including work rights and duration limits. Being informed about these can maximize both your educational and professional opportunities.
  • Work Experience: Many countries offer post-graduate work visas that allow you to gain valuable local work experience—an essential factor for most permanent residency applications.

Post-Graduation Work Opportunities

After your studies, leveraging work opportunities is crucial. Countries like Canada, Australia, and Germany provide special post-graduation work permits that can be your ticket to gaining necessary on-the-job experience. Here’s what you should keep in mind:

  • Occupational Demand: Research industries that are in high demand in your host country. Aligning your skillset with local needs boosts your job prospects and strengthens your residency application.
  • Skill Development: Pursue roles that enhance your professional skills and expand your network. This not only improves your resume but also showcases adaptability—a key trait for residency consideration.

Pathways to Permanent Residency

Most countries offer specific residency pathways tailored for students and skilled professionals. Understanding these avenues is fundamental to planning your transition.

  1. Points-Based Systems: Countries like Australia and Canada use points-based systems that reward age, education, language proficiency, and work experience. As an international graduate, you may already qualify for substantial points.

  2. Employer-Sponsored Visas: Establishing strong professional connections can lead to employer sponsorship for a work visa, a significant milestone towards permanent residency.

  3. Regional and Provincial Nomination Programs: Explore regional programs that prioritize certain professions, academic achievements, and even regional residency.

The Importance of Documentation

Robust documentation is critical when seeking to transition from a student visa to permanent residency. Stay organized with:

  • Academic Transcripts and Qualifications
  • Employment Offer Letters and Contracts
  • Letters of Recommendation

Ensuring these documents are accurate and up-to-date will smooth your transition process.
